[QUOTE="UtkNate, post: 7460498, member: 635788"] I'm sure this has been beat to death on this forum but I couldn't figure out what to search since 1 vs. 2 subs has too short of words. I also know that this is not an exact science, different brands, watts, etc will make the results different. Having said this I would like to know in general which is better to shoot for? So my first set-up was 2 Alpine Type-R 12s powered with 900 wrms at 2 Ohms. For this set-up I am really impressed with Sundown SA-12s and many people power them with 1k wrms daily so I would like to get one of them. So say both in proper boxes and powered with the same amount of power which would you rather have? Im sure the 2 subs would be louder but by how much? So I guess the main thing is, for example, say you have $500 to spend on subs alone; would you rather buy a single beast $500 sub or 2x $250 subs? Why? [/QUOTE]
